CHARGING TIME USB CORD COMPUTER
The battery charges to 80% in approximately three hours and 100% in
approximately four hours. When using Tactacam's USB cord connect-
ed to a computer for charging, it is best to have the camera powered
off. Charge times may vary depending on your computer's USB output
settings.
USING THE CAMERA WHILE CHARGING
Control the Tactacam FISH-i while the camera is plugged into a USB
charging adapter. (You cannot record while charging the camera
through a computer.) Your Tactacam FISH-I can also capture video
when connected to a USB external charging device. Make sure to use
the power adapting back cap. This power adapting back cap is not
waterproof.

BATTERY STORAGE AND HANDLING

The camera contains sensitive components, including the battery. Avoid
exposing your camera to extreme temperatures. Low or high tempera-
ture conditions may temporarily shorten the battery life or cause the
camera to temporarily stop working properly. Avoid dramatic change in
temperature or humidity when using the camera, as condensation may
form on or within the camera.
When storing your Tactacam, charge the battery so it's 75% or higher.
